Transaction 37fbef7b8bcdc1c10701da2ac8dafc4036a082470d31250c85fb4f724d826b7e
1 Input
2 Outputs
- 37fbef7b8bcdc1c10701da2ac8dafc4036a082470d31250c85fb4f724d826b7e:0
- 37fbef7b8bcdc1c10701da2ac8dafc4036a082470d31250c85fb4f724d826b7e:1
value 43525636
address 1BC8KCDDuDCoF19b7eBSGw6W45A6k8mVWp
value 18750000
address 1Li5Ary1gvYT2orZiU3Sw3Sy6osDEboh8R